3 Use the sequence below to complete each task. -13, -15, -17, -19, ... a. Identify the common difference (d). b. Write an equation to represent the sequence. C. Find the 15th term (as) WIE A Alta

The given sequence is


-13,-15,-17,-19,\ldots

As you can notice, this sequence is about negative numbers only, also, the number is increasing in the absolute value of 2 units each time. This means its difference is -2, let's prove it


\begin{gathered} -13-2=-15 \\ -15-2=-17 \\ -17-2=-19 \end{gathered}

So, the answer to (a) is 2.

This arithmetic sequence can be defined with the following formula


a_n=a_1+(n-1)d

Where,


\begin{gathered} a_1=-13 \\ d=-2 \end{gathered}

Replacing these values, we find the equation for the sequence


\begin{gathered} a_n=-13+(n-1)(-2) \\ a_n=-13-2n+2 \\ a_n=-2n-11 \end{gathered}

Therefore, the answer so (b) is


a_n=-2n-11

At last, to find the 15th term, we just replace n=15 in the equation


a_(15)=-2(15)-11=-30-11=-41

Therefore, the answer to (c) is -41.
